You can use below command to alter to partition ./bin/kafka-topics.sh --alter --zookeeper localhost:2181 --topic my-topic --partitions 6

On Mon, 22 Jun 2020 at 6:31 AM, Liam Clarke-Hutchinson < liam.cla...@adscale.co.nz> wrote: > Hi Sunil, > > The broker setting num.partitions only applies to automatically created > topics (if that is enabled) at the time of creation. To change partitions > for a topic you need to use kafka-topics.sh to do so for each topic. > > Kind regards, > > Liam Clarke-Hutchinson > > On Mon, Jun 22, 2020 at 3:16 AM sunil chaudhari < > sunilmchaudhar...@gmail.com> > wrote: > > > Hi, > > I want to change number of partitions for all topics. > > How can I change that?
